Can Fido Feast on Basil? Uncover the Truth Here!

Can Dogs Eat Basil?

Yes, dogs can safely consume basil in moderation. This fragrant herb is not only safe for dogs but also offers various health benefits. Let’s explore why basil can be a great addition to your furry friend’s diet.

5.1. Signs of Basil Allergy in Dogs

Have you ever wondered how to tell if your dog is having an allergic reaction to basil? Well, keep an eye out for symptoms such as itching, redness, swelling, hives, or even gastrointestinal issues like vomiting or diarrhea. These signs could indicate that your pup is not tolerating basil well.

5.2. Intolerance vs. Allergy to Basil in Dogs

Is it an intolerance or a full-blown allergy that your dog is experiencing? Understanding the difference is key. While an intolerance may lead to digestive discomfort, an allergy can trigger more severe reactions like difficulty breathing or even anaphylaxis. It’s essential to consult with your vet to get a proper diagnosis.

Guidelines for Feeding Basil to Dogs

Curious about how to incorporate basil into your dog’s meals? When it comes to feeding basil to your dog, moderation is key. You can sprinkle some fresh basil leaves on top of your dog’s food or mix it into homemade treats for a flavorful twist. Remember to wash the basil thoroughly and chop it into small, manageable pieces to prevent choking hazards. Start with small amounts to see how your dog reacts and gradually increase the quantity if they enjoy it. Always consult your veterinarian before making any significant changes to your dog’s diet.
